With larger lobes than Torx bits, these deliver even more torque without slipping and stripping the drive. They have a similar profile to Torx but are not recommended for use with standard Torx screws.
Hex Shank—Also known as insert bits, these snap into hand tools. If you want to use them with power tools, attach a bit adapter (not included).
Quick-Change Hex Shank—Lock these bits directly into power tools. They won't wobble as much as bits paired with an adapter, so they are the best choice for high-precision tasks.
Steel—Best for dry environments, since moisture will cause these bits to rust.
